> The HAWQ page looks nice, however there are a few problems with it.
> The phrase
> "Plus, HAWQ® works Apache MADlib) machine learning libraries"
> does not read well. Something missing?
> The first/main references to ASF products such as Hadoop, YARN etc must use the full name, i.e. Apache Hadoop etc.
> The download section does not have any link to the KEYS file, nor any instructions on how to use the KEYS+sig or hashes to validate downloads.
> The download section still includes references to MD5 hashes.
> These are deprecated and can be removed for older releases that have other hashes
